Summary

With a Good rating from Ofsted, this primary school demonstrates strong parent satisfaction, boasting a 100% recommendation rate from surveyed families. The school excels in achieving 71% of pupils meeting expected standards in reading, writing, and maths at KS2, placing it in the top 33% nationally. However, there is room for improvement in achieving higher standards, as none of the students reached this benchmark.

Frequently asked questions
What is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School rated by Ofsted?

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School was rated "Good"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 1 October 2024.

Is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School a good school?

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School scores 68.8/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the top 31%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.

What do parents say about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School?

Based on 34 Ofsted Parent View responses, Furness Vale Primary and Nursery School receives a satisfaction score of 84% across all parent survey questions.
